Sounds like you have some network issues, that is definitely not the way the system is supposed to respond.

The first step I would take is a simple refresh of the network, by unplugging all Sonos devices from power. While they are powered down, reboot your router. Once the router comes back up, plug back in the Sonos devices and see if this behaviour continues. If it does not, you may want to look into reserving IP addresses for all your network devices in your router, instructions would be in your routers manual.

While I suspect that process will resolve the issue, there is a small chance that it may not. If not, after the system locks up and you reset it, submit a system diagnostic within 10 minutes of the reset, and call Sonos Support to discuss it.

There may be information included in the diagnostic that will help Sonos pinpoint the issue and help you find a solution.

When you speak directly to the phone folks, they have tools at their disposal that will allow them to give you advice specific to your Sonos system and network.
